冷轧薄板激光焊机激光梁伺服控制的实现
王立伟,杨洪,董砚,王睿
(河北工业大学控制科学与工程学院.天津300130)
摘要:本文针对冷轧薄板激光焊接的控制特点,研究了焊机激光梁的工艺控制流程,并据此提出了实现该动作过
程的伺服控制方案。系统主要吐I西门子S7—400、SIMODPdVE61IU变频器、lFK7交流同步伺服电机等来组成。采
用PROFIBUS一3DP通信,保证了参数的快建、准确传递。实现了激光梁伺服控制的快速性和准确性。
关键词:激光焊机;PROFIBUS通信;变频器;定位控制
